Rear brakes C43
Servicing brake caliper

Rear brakes with automatic adjustment

Notes:

  • ◆ Always install the complete repair kit.
  • ◆ After replacing brake pads, depress brake pedal firmly several times with vehicle stationary so that the brake pads are properly seated in the normal operating position.
  • ◆ To draw off brake fluid from the reservoir, use a bleeder bottle which is used only for brake fluid. Brake fluid is poisonous and must on no account be siphoned by mouth through a hose.
 
A46-0162
  • ◆ Brakes can be checked on any commercially available brake test stand, provided that the driving speed of the two driving rollers of the test stand is not more than 5.5 km/h.
  • ◆ The tightening torque of the brake pipes is 15 Nm.
  • Hexagon socket head bolt, 60 Nm
    • ◆ M10 x 40
  • Brake carrier with guide pin and protective cap
    • ◆ Supplied as replacement part assembled with sufficient quantities of grease on guide pins
    • ◆ If protective caps or guide pins are damaged, install repair kit. Use grease sachet supplied to lubricate guide pins.
  • Hexagon socket head bolt, 60 Nm
    • ◆ M10 x 65
 
A46-0162
  • Brake pads
    • ◆ Always replace all components on an axle
    • ◆ Do not disconnect brake hose when changing brake pads
    • ◆ Inner brake pad with wear indicator
    • ◆ Removing and installing
    • ◆ Checking thickness:

  • Brake disc
    • ◆ Always replace all components on an axle
    • ◆ Arrow points in running direction
    • ◆ Different versions on left and right
    • ◆ Remove brake caliper prior to removing
    • ◆ Lubricate contact surfaces between brake disc and wheel hub with polyurea grease G 052 142 A2.
    • ◆ Ensure adequate wear reserve

  • Wheel bolts
    • ◆ Tightening torque 140 Nm
  • Hexagon bolt, Self-locking, 35 Nm
    • ◆ Always replace
    • ◆ When loosening and tightening counter hold on guide pin
  • Seals
  • Banjo bolt 45 Nm
  • Brake pipe with banjo union
    • ◆ Hose must be attached without twisting
  • Brake caliper housing
    • ◆ Unscrew from brake carrier to replace brake pads
    • ◆ Hose must be attached without twisting
    • ◆ Do not disconnect brake hose when changing brake pads
    • ◆ Servicing brake caliper => Page 47-34
